题目内容

设计一个算法,利用栈的基本运算返回给定栈中的栈底元素,要求仍保持栈中元素次序不变。这里只能使用栈st的基本运算来完成,不能直接用st. data[0]来得到栈底元素。

查看答案
更多问题

回文指的是一个字符串从前面读和从后面读都一样,如"abcba"、"123454321"都是回文。设计一个算法利用顺序栈的基本运算判断一个字符串是否为回文。

设计一个算法,判断一个可能含有小括号('('与')'、)、中括号('['与']')和大括号('{'与'}')的表达式中各类括号是否匹配。若匹配,则返回1;否则返回0。

简要说明线性表、栈与队的异同点。

当用一维数组实现顺序栈时,为什么一般将栈底设置在数组的一端,而不是设置在中间?

答案查题题库